I'll try to take some pictures of the sample swatches for the two new 2018 color schemes this weekend. The Smoke River is a charcoal wood grain and seating material with tan patterned compliment trim. The Pecan Decor is wood that is a little darker than the Birch but not as red as the Cherry. This one uses tan seating material and a charcoal compliment trim. If you go ultra-leather, they now have a charcoal and darker tan material compared to the current lighter tan.

I do not have the storage slide in mine, we wanted the weight savings. I just got a 5ft long dowel, put a storage hook on the end, and presto chango, I can easily retrieve or push storage boxes into the basement.
The generator compartment can be easily extended downward.
I also changed the round sewer storage system to a square vinyl fence post because the good hoses do not fit.
Last, we also run a 1.3kw PSW Inverter/charger with boost along with 4ea 6v cells in a star config (2 in the battery compartment, 2 in the generator compartment). Works great, and I can run the A/C off a 2k generator along with the 320watts of solar on the roof.
